Serpeck's method involves the heating of bauxite with

Serpeck's method involves the heating of bauxite with

WEBIn Serpeck's method white bauxite is heated with coke in presence of N 2 gas. A l 2 O 3 + N 2 + 3 C Δ 3 CO + 2 A lN A lN + 3 H 2 O N H 3 + 2 A l (O H) 3 Aluminium nitride formed in 1 st step is reacted with water to produce A l (O H) 3 which gives A l 2 O 3 on ignition.

Concentration of Ores

Concentration of Ores

WEBThe first step is to heat the bauxite ore to temperatures of 200°c along with a sodium hydroxide solution. This will convert the aluminium oxide to a solution of sodium aluminate. The silica will dissolve itself in the process. The chemical equation is. Al 2 O 3 + 2 NaOH → 2 NaAlO 2 + H 2 O.

Bauxite: The principal ore of aluminum.

Bauxite: The principal ore of aluminum.

WEBBauxite is the principal ore of aluminum. The first step in producing aluminum is to crush the bauxite and purify it using the Bayer Process. In the Bayer Process, the bauxite is washed in a hot solution of sodium hydroxide, which leaches aluminum from the bauxite. The aluminum is precipitated out of solution in the form of aluminum hydroxide ...
